The chloride process is used to separate titanium from its ores. In this process, the feedstock is treated at 1000 °C with carbon and chlorine gas, giving titanium tetrachloride.Typical is the conversion starting from the ore ilmenite:. 2 FeTiO 3 + 7 Cl 2 + 6 C → 2 TiCl 4 + 2 FeCl 3 + 6 CO. The process is a variant of a carbothermic reaction, which exploits the reducing power of carbon.

The sulphate process employs simpler technology than the chloride route and can use lower grade, cheaper ores. However, it generally has higher production costs and with acid treatment is more expensive to build than a chloride plant. (c) Formation of anhydrous titanium dioxide. The final stage of the process is the heating of the solid in a furnace, known as a calciner. This is a rotating cylinder which is typically heated by gas flames. As the cylinder turns, the titanium dioxide passes along it and its temperature rises from 313 K, as it enters, to over 1000 K as it leaves:
The Kroll Process is the ideal way of producing titanium for commercial use. It has replaced the Hunter Process of reducing titanium tetrachloride with sodium to produce pure titanium. (1) This is due to the fact that the Kroll Process is more economical, because the use of magnesium, as a reductant, is cheaper than using sodium.

Most ilmenite is mined for titanium dioxide production.Ilmenite is a titanium bearing mineral that, directly or indirectly, supplies in excess of 90% of the feedstock to the large titanium dioxide pigment industry as well as to the very significant and growing titanium metal market and some smaller industrial applications. Titanium dioxide, also known as titanium(IV) oxide or titania, is the naturally occurring oxide of titanium, chemical formula TiO 2.When used as a pigment, it is called titanium white, Pigment White 6 (PW6), or CI 77891.Generally, it is sourced from ilmenite, rutile, and anatase.It has a wide range of applications, including paint, sunscreen, and food coloring.
